Output ec648785d90ad0528c6b4ee627448dadf57762dd8493deb415ab2d97ce7f33f8:1

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d79ed6ee998a2e9ec8a0791e27368fca15500ef OP_EQUAL
address
3QoGwkEbRK9rQrdSZaFjFjSqQ2Hrdoc9EC
transaction
ec648785d90ad0528c6b4ee627448dadf57762dd8493deb415ab2d97ce7f33f8
confirmations
457033
spent
true